Monte Carlo Landau 1975 the engine bay looks exceptional authentic and so you will love telling people this is the numbers-matching 350 cubic-inch V8. Ultra-low 20k miles and a well-respected life mean this one fires up nicely. It also keeps its easy-cruising attitude with great driving features like power steering, power brakes, front discs, a 3-speed automatic transmission, and sway bars front & rear. This color combo looks particularly striking, thanks to the stellar condition of the interior. It’s all part of a full preservation where there’s not even a button missing from the two wide bench seats. Plus, the door panels, headliner, and dash all retain a beautiful gray appearance too. Even the carpeting remains 1970s plush. It’s a true time capsule, right down to the condition of the burled walnut applique and the 8-track AM radio that’s cranking out tunes. This car has never been in the rain or snow, as you can see from the pictures, the underbody is very clean and coated. This 1975 Chevrolet Monte Carlo Landau is an awesome classic with only 20K miles on the odometer. That kind of little use created an exceptional survivor that can amaze fans of true factory style and that’s even before you check out the full level of preservation on this dark blue stunner. All chrome is perfect.
